web前端要用什么工具
-
Web前端开发人员需要使用一系列工具来提高工作效率和开发质量。以下是几种常用的工具:
-
编辑器:Web前端开发的第一步是选择一个适合自己的编辑器。常见的编辑器包括Sublime Text、Visual Studio Code和Atom等。这些编辑器具有代码高亮、语法检查、自动完成等功能,可以提高编码的效率和准确性。
-
版本控制系统:在团队协作中,版本控制系统是必不可少的。Git是最受欢迎的版本控制系统,可以帮助开发人员管理代码版本、解决冲突和合并代码等操作。常用的Git服务有GitHub、GitLab和Bitbucket等。
-
包管理工具:前端开发涉及到大量的第三方库和插件,为了方便管理和更新这些依赖,可以使用包管理工具。常见的包管理工具有npm和Yarn,可以通过它们来安装、升级和删除依赖。
-
构建工具:前端开发中,构建工具是用来自动化项目构建、代码编译、打包和优化的工具。常用的构建工具有Webpack和Gulp,它们可以自动化一些繁琐的工作,如CSS和JavaScript的压缩、图片的优化等。
-
调试工具:在开发过程中,调试工具是必不可少的。浏览器的开发者工具可以用来检查HTML、CSS和JavaScript的错误,并且可以在运行时修改代码和查看网络请求等。Chrome的开发者工具是最常用的调试工具,其他浏览器也有自己的类似工具。
-
后端接口工具:前端开发时,往往需要和后端进行接口交互。常用的后端接口工具有Postman和Insomnia等,可以模拟发送请求、调试接口、查看响应等。
-
终端工具:在一些特定的情景下,终端工具是解决问题的好帮手。在Mac和Linux系统中,可以使用内置的终端工具,而在Windows系统中,可以使用Cmder等第三方终端模拟器。
总之,选择合适的工具可以提高前端开发的效率和质量,让开发人员更加专注于业务逻辑和用户体验的实现。
2年前 -
-
作为一名Web前端开发人员,有很多工具可以帮助你提高工作效率和代码质量。以下是一些常用的工具:
-
代码编辑器:一个好的代码编辑器是开发前端项目的基础。常用的代码编辑器有Visual Studio Code、Sublime Text、Atom等。这些编辑器都具有语法高亮、代码自动补全、代码片段等功能,使得编写代码更加方便。
-
包管理工具:在前端开发中,使用包管理器可以轻松地管理和安装第三方库、框架和插件。常用的包管理工具包括npm、yarn等。通过这些工具可以方便地在项目中引入所需的依赖项。
-
版本控制工具:使用版本控制工具可以帮助你跟踪、管理和协作开发项目的代码。最常用的版本控制系统是Git。Git可以帮助你管理代码的不同版本,合并代码,解决冲突等。
-
前端框架:前端框架可以帮助开发人员快速构建用户界面。一些常用的前端框架包括React、Vue.js、Angular等。这些框架提供了一系列的工具、组件和模块,简化了前端开发的过程。
-
调试工具:在开发过程中,调试是一个重要的环节。浏览器自带的开发者工具是前端调试的利器,可以检查元素、调试JavaScript代码、监控网络请求等。此外,还有一些第三方工具可以辅助调试,例如React Developer Tools、Vue Devtools等。
这些工具只是Web前端开发中的一小部分,还有很多其他的工具可以用来优化性能、测试代码、自动化工作流等。选择合适的工具可以极大地提高开发效率和代码质量。对于不同的项目和个人偏好,可能会选择不同的工具组合。重要的是要熟悉工具的使用,并不断学习和掌握新的工具和技术。
2年前 -
-
作为Web前端开发人员,需要使用以下工具来提高效率和质量:
-
文本编辑器:选择合适的文本编辑器来编写代码。常用的文本编辑器有Sublime Text、Visual Studio Code、Atom等。这些编辑器提供了代码高亮、代码折叠、自动完成等功能,使得编写代码更加方便快捷。
-
版本控制工具:使用版本控制工具来管理代码的变更。Git是最常用的版本控制工具,可以帮助团队协同开发、回滚代码、解决冲突等。常用的Git客户端有Git Bash、SourceTree、GitHub Desktop等。
-
包管理工具:使用包管理工具来管理项目依赖的插件和库。NPM(Node Package Manager)是常用的包管理工具,提供了一个庞大的包仓库,可以快速安装、升级和删除依赖包。另外,还有Yarn等包管理工具可供选择。
-
调试工具:使用调试工具定位和修复代码中的错误。浏览器自带的开发者工具(如Chrome DevTools)是最常用的调试工具。它们可以检查页面结构、查看网络请求、修改CSS样式、调试JavaScript代码等。
-
图像编辑工具:使用图像编辑工具来处理、优化和编辑图片。Photoshop、Sketch、GIMP等工具可以帮助你裁剪图片大小、优化图像质量、调整颜色和对齐图层等。
-
网络工具:使用网络工具来模拟不同网络环境和测试性能。常见的网络工具有Charles Proxy、Postman、Fiddler等,它们可以模拟慢速网络、拦截和修改请求、测试API接口等。
-
构建工具:使用构建工具来自动化构建和部署任务。常用的构建工具有Webpack、Gulp、Grunt等,它们可以帮助你优化代码、压缩和合并文件、编译CSS预处理器、自动刷新浏览器等。
-
测试工具:使用测试工具来保证代码质量和功能完备性。常用的测试工具有Jest、Mocha、Selenium等,它们可以进行单元测试、端到端测试、性能测试等。
-
在线协作工具:使用在线协作工具与团队成员进行沟通和协作。常用的在线协作工具有Slack、Trello、GitHub等,它们可以用于沟通、项目管理、版本控制和文档共享等。
除了以上工具,还要持续学习、关注最新的前端技术和工具,不断提升自己的前端开发技术。
2年前 -